Monarch - Using Clarity to Sync Outlook Contacts to Monarch

Contacts that you have in Outlook at not automatically assumed to be business contacts that you want in Monarch. I don’t know about you, but sometimes my dentist, uncle, or spam contacts sneak into my Outlook and I don’t want them in Monarch. That’s why we make it easy to sync a contact from Outlook to Monarch but didn’t go so far as to automatically assume and pull them in for you.

The easiest way to get started is to do the following steps:

1. Click on the Notification bell located on the right top of the page.

2. Look for a new notification that looks like below. Note: If you don't see the new notificaiton, please make sure the notificaiton is enabled. Please see the last section of this page to enable to the noticifation. 

3. Cick into the new notificaiton (“X Contacts from Outlook Could be Added to Monarch”). This will load the expanded view of the notification where you can review the potential contacts and either Accept them as a contact or Reject. 

The expanded view will display a screen detailing those contacts First Name, Last Name, Company, and the first date they were found with Created Date. It’s important to note that these are not YET contacts. They similar to the Potential Contacts at this point and we’re merely surfacing them as Contacts you might want added to Monarch.

4. Click Actions button for each contact and select either Accept or Reject the contact. It is recommended that you choose one of these two options and keep this list clean for the most optimal experience of easily managing contacts.

  • Accept – This will copy any information from Outlook (even information not displayed on this screen) into the Add a Contact dialog box where you can easily edit and then Save the contact. Once saved this contact will no longer display for this notification. Changes made to the contact in Monarch or Outlook will update the other location, keeping them in sync.
  • Reject – This will launch a confirmation dialog making sure yo want to remove the contact from the Potential Outlook Contacts notification. Doing so will no longer try to bring that contact into Monarch for you, but it will continue to exist in Outlook.

Clarity will ignore any contacts that you’ve previously added or already exist in Monarch based upon the email address.

To enabled Potential Outlook Contacts That Can Be Created In Monarch notificaiton, please follow the below steps:

1. Click on the Notification bell located on the right top of the page.

2. Click the gear icon.

3. Select Default Notificaitons tab.

4. Make sure that the Potential Outlook Contacts That Can Be Created In Monarch is set to On. 

5. Please log out by clicking your name on the top right of the page and select Logout. Then login again. This will activate the notification.
